Frank Lampard to miss match against New England while Pilro prepare for debut



It seems like New York City FC will have to wait another week to see Frank Lampard in action with their team's colors in match play.


Several New York outlets reported on Friday that Lampard will not travel up to Foxborough, Massachusetts for Saturday night's game against the New England Revolution.


Lampard had a calf injury while training earlier this month, forcing him out of last week's match against Toronto FC. The knock is not yet fully healed, prompted NYCFC's technical staff to avoid the risk of extending the midfielder's injury.


He started training again this week, and is expected to be ready to go for next week's game against Orlando 
City SC.


If that is the case, both Lampard and fellow new arrival Andrea Pirlo could make their MLS debuts on the same day.
